Executioner

A class for Old-School Essentials

Written by Derik A. Badman,


inspired by Gene Wolfe.

Requirements: None
Prime requisite: CHA
Hit Dice: 1d6
Maximum level: 14
Armour: Any (but see below)
Weapons: Any
Languages: Alignment, Common
Alignment: Any Lawful

As an executioner you have been trained from youth to serve as jailor, interrogator, and executioner
for your sovereign. In the realms of men your status gives you influence over the people via fear and
intimidation, while your knowledge of the body serves to both heal and harm.

Starting Equipment
Fuligin cloak (a blacker than black cloak)
Executioner's weapon (a well maintained weapon, probably a heavy sword or ax)
Mask (a fearsome mask to hide your identity and intimidate the populace)
Seal of office (as appropriate to sovereign/rank)

Hide In Shadows
While wearing your fuligin cloak (or similarly dark covering garment), you can hide in shadows like
the thief class. The fuligin cloak cannot be worn effectively over armor heavier than leather.
Hide in Shadows is rolled on 1d6. If the roll is within the listed range of numbers on the level
progression table, the skill succeeds.

Physiology Skill
You have been trained in the physiology of the human (or humanoid) body to know how to both
harm and heal (one does not want to lose a prisoner during/after interrogation). With this skill you can
do such things as identify causes of death, identify weak points of bodies, and aid in healing. Under your
care you can double a body's healing rate (i.e. 2d3 hp per day of rest). Any other uses of your skill are at
the referee's discretion.

Intimidate
Your station and imposing demeanor (via your accoutrements of office) can be used to intimidate
people who understand your language or accept the validity of your office/sovereign.
Roll 2d6 and consult the Intimidation Table. -1 to rolls when not wearing at least 2 of your mask,
cloak, and seal.
If the attempt succeeds, roll 2d6 to determine the number of HD affected, at least one person will
always be affected, starting with the lowest HD.
Intimidated people (result of S): The referee will decide the result, this may involve adjusting the
reaction result one place (or triggering a reaction roll with a bonus). It will not always yield a positive
result. A town guard inclined to be friendly to strangers, may change their mind when an executioner
starts off trying to pull rank.
Cowed people (result of C): The referee will decide the result, with a more effective result than a
simple success. Cowed people may offer information unasked, surrender, or just cower in fear, as
appropriate to the person/group.

After Reaching 11th Level


You may be granted the title of Master by your sovereign and given 1d6 1st level students to train.

Author's Note
This is obviously (for those familiar) based on the Torturer's Guild in Gene Wolfe's _The Book of the
New Sun_. I didn't use the name "torturer" to steer away from the idea that the character would be out
there torturing people. Perhaps "enforcer" would have worked as a name too. I don't play with players
who are min/maxers or competitive with each other, so I went for flavor more than balance. Maybe
some people would find this class unbalanced, in which case one could up the XP requirements for level
or add more restrictions to armor/weapon use. You could even add that the class gets a penalty for
using any weapon that isn't their starting weapon (or one gotten from another of the class).
